The story
Inside the Four Seasons Hotel Abu Dhabi at Al Maryah Island, Butcher & Still channels a 1920s Chicago steakhouse. Leather banquettes, rich wood floors, and a bar built for Prohibition-era cocktails set the tone. The restaurant is a deliberate departure from the glass-and-steel towers outside, offering a space that feels both timeless and transportive.
The kitchen focuses on prime cuts of American beef, with the Butcher & Still Signature Tomahawk Chop — a 21-day aged bone-in rib-eye — as a centerpiece. Beyond steak, the menu includes a 99% Lump Crab Cake with scallop and remoulade, and a Cherry Pie à la Mode created by the executive pastry chef, made with two types of sweet and sour cherries and served with vanilla ice cream and caramel sauce. A signature Masterdish, The Tribune Tower, layers Valrhona chocolate 34 times as a nod to Chicago’s iconic 1920s skyscraper.
A hidden passage leads to The Hideaway, an ultra-exclusive private dining room accessed by a secret elevator — a true speakeasy within the restaurant. Daily happy hour runs from 4:00 pm to 7:00 pm, with weekly specials like King Crab Mondays and Oyster Fridays, plus a Caviar and Champagne Experience pairing premium caviar with Perrier-Jouët.
Butcher & Still was selected by the Michelin Guide in 2026, and has also been recognized by Gault & Millau and named Restaurant of the Year by What’s On Abu Dhabi. It’s a confident, grown-up take on the classic American steakhouse — polished, atmospheric, and built for lingering over a proper drink.
